Certain individuals achieved cultural influence that transcended their specific artistic or creative fields, becoming symbols of broader social transformations and shaping how entire generations expressed identity, challenged conventions, and imagined alternative possibilities. This exploration examines figures whose innovations in art, music, fashion, or performance catalyzed cultural shifts, using contemporary documentation, media coverage, and cultural reception to reconstruct how individual vision achieved mass influence. From Coco Chanel's redefinition of women's fashion to Miles Davis's musical innovations, from Andy Warhol's Pop Art challenge to high culture boundaries to David Bowie's gender performance experimentation, discover how these figures positioned themselves at intersections of artistic innovation and social change. Examine the contexts that enabled their influence—technological changes in media distribution, generational tensions seeking new forms of expression, economic shifts creating new consumer markets, political movements demanding cultural representation. Documentary evidence—interviews, critical reviews, sales figures, censorship battles, fan correspondence—reveals how contemporaries recognized these figures' subversive potential while audiences embraced their challenges to established norms. Media coverage shows how controversy amplified visibility, transforming artistic innovation into cultural phenomenon. Each case study analyzes factors beyond individual talent that enabled cultural impact. Understand how timing intersected with vision, how commercial success paradoxically validated countercultural authenticity, how media representation shaped public persona, and how these icons became templates for subsequent cultural movements.
